Nehemiah 1-3

Sometimes it only takes one God motivated person to inspire a whole generation.  For a period when the exiles began trickeling back to Jerusalem Nehemiah was that man. God had given him a message that Jerusalem was in disarray. But what could a lowly servant of the king do? There is no indication that Nehemiah had trained in leadership skills.  All I can figure is that Nehemiah picked up his leadership skills from observing the king of Persia.  When God connected those observations with the humility of a servant of his the results were amazing.
